Summary: | A series of substituted amides of 3-carboxypicolinic acid have been synthesized via the interaction of quinolinic acid anhydride with alkyl(aryl)amines. Their structures were studied by ¹H and ¹³C NMR spectroscopy. The direction of the reaction was explained by quantum-chemistry methods. Three compounds demonstrated hemostatic activity. Two substances exhibited anticoagulant properties. Most substances also exhibited weak bacteriostatic activity. |
